Simon-Pierre Monette leads Boston Consulting Group’s Industrial Goods practice in Canada and is also active in the energy and infrastructure sectors. Simon-Pierre works with clients across a range of challenges and topics with a focus on strategy, operating model transformations, and operations.
Simon-Pierre worked at BCG from 2013 to 2018 and rejoined the firm in 2020. Outside of BCG, Simon-Pierre worked at Booz&Co (now Strategy&, part of PWC) in the Middle East in infrastructure and energy, at ABB and Alstom in the power generation industry, and with mining and metals giant Rio Tinto.
